Experts predict that the US is trying to research and master Russian flight technology on the Su-27 fighter and encountered an unfortunate accident.

During a test flight near Nillis Air Force Base in Nevada, a Su-27 fighter jet crashed. Pilot Lt. Col. Eric Schultz, 44, died from his injuries.

Despite attempts to cover up the incident, the Iz.ru news portal discovered a report about the crash of a Su-27 fighter jet in Nevada. According to the source, the crash occurred 160 km northwest of Nellis Air Force Base, located near Las Vegas.

Why did the US want to cover up this accident? The commander of Nellis Air Force Base initially tried to cover up the accident and refused to disclose it, leading to various speculations in the media.
